overshadowEtymology
Old English ofersceadwian(see over-, shadow)Definitions
1. exceed in importanceExamples
- « outweigh »
- « This problem overshadows our lives right now »
- 2. make appear small by comparison
Examples
- « This year's debt dwarves that of last year »
Derived terms
- 3. cast a shadow upon
Examples
- « The tall tree overshadowed the house »
- « The tragedy overshadowed the couple's happiness »
